If you've recently captured high-resolution footage on a modern GoPro—such as the HERO13 Black, HERO12, or HERO11—you might find that your Windows 10 PC refuses to play the files. This is because GoPro uses the , also known as H.265, to maintain high image quality at half the file size of older formats.
